Output 50e85f61fe19d0f9cf3c945b0de165c6e2e6a0bac157e65f8a4e44179c19ca1d:0

value
877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 574eb6cbd20031291a4a1b14883a5508a5e6032a OP_EQUAL
address
39ef1P3ckVj7NgD4q1SRVZV5b6W35CwpXb
transaction
50e85f61fe19d0f9cf3c945b0de165c6e2e6a0bac157e65f8a4e44179c19ca1d
confirmations
25737
spent
true